IFES is co-hosting a symposium on electoral reform and elections administration in Armenia from November 22nd and 23rd in Yerevan. The symposium will address Armenia’s current draft electoral code legislation and provide regional and international perspective to Armenia’s overall electoral development. Representatives of the National Assembly, the Central Election Commission, civil society, political parties, the Government, the Presidential Administration of the Republic of Armenia and the international community will attend and participate in this important symposium of discussion and debate. The symposium is jointly sponsored by the United States Agency for International Development, the Council of Europe, the Delegation of the European Union to Armenia, and the Organization for Security and Cooperation in Europe.

Presenters will include Davit Harutyunyan, Chairman of the Standing Committee on State and Legal Affairs of the National Assembly of RA and electoral experts from around the world. The symposium is designed in a working group format to provide the opportunity for participants to actively discuss international perspectives in election administration, political and campaign finance, use of administrative resources, electoral disputes and adjudication and election fraud prevention.
